Valmet to supply green liquor clarifier to Stora Enso Skoghall mill in Sweden

Finland-headed forest industry and energy technology provider Valmet Oyj has announced that it will supply an "OptiClear" green liquor clarifier to Stora Enso Skoghall mill in Sweden. The start-up of the clarifier is planned for spring 2020.

Valmet will supply an “OptiClear” green liquor clarifier to Stora Enso Skoghall mill in Sweden  (photo courtesy Stora Enso).

According to a statement, Valmet’s scope of supply includes a new OptiClear with polymer station and instruments, electrical motors, platforms, piping, and installation work. The value of the order has not been disclosed.

Valmet’s OptiClear will increase the availability of the green liquor plant and deliver a cleaner green liquor to slaking. This will, in turn, contribute to stabilizing the liquor circuit at the mill. Operation of the OptiClear is easy and less maintenance is required compared to our present equipment. It will also be possible to use this equipment in future rebuilds, explained Michelle Nylander, Production Manager, Power Recovery and Environment, at Stora Enso’s mill in Skoghall.

The Skoghall mill in Sweden is a world-class producer of carton board and barrier coating for demanding consumer packaging, including liquid and food packaging. The annual capacity is 775 000 tonnes board and 635 000 tonnes pulp.
